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

Vamos explorar um exemplo realmente exclusivo de agrupamento ou segmentação do LuckyTemplates neste tutorial. Você pode assistir ao vídeo completo deste tutorial na parte inferior deste blog.

Criaremos um agrupamento de balancetes antigos dentro do LuckyTemplates . Essa técnica envolve a reutilização de muitos dos padrões de agrupamento e segmentação que já aprendemos. A utilização de padrões de agrupamento do LuckyTemplates para este exemplo exclusivo não é diferente.

A ideia por trás deste tutorial é mostrar como você pode utilizar alguns padrões comuns de agrupamento ou segmentação no LuckyTemplates.

Na verdade, este tutorial surgiu de uma pergunta no Fórum de suporte do LuckyTemplates , que se baseia em requisitos de relatórios contábeis e balancetes antigos.

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

Os balancetes de idade, em contabilidade, nos fornecem uma divisão de nossos recebíveis com saldos pendentes e nos mostram o quão longe eles estão. E assim, ao longo do tempo, podemos ver se temos muitos recebíveis vencendo em 60, 90, 120 dias ou no próximo mês, etc.

Com esse tipo de análise, queremos agrupar os dados e simplificar o relatório. Usaremos alguns cálculos DAX avançados para fazer isso. Antes de chegarmos à fórmula, vamos dar uma olhada rápida nos dados de amostra que criei para este tutorial.

Índice

Conjunto de dados de amostra e configuração do modelo

Nesta tabela, temos as colunas Data de Compensação e Data de Vencimento e queremos calcular a diferença entre essas duas datas. Em seguida, agruparemos ou segmentaremos essas diferenças de data com base em qualquer grupo que selecionarmos e faremos isso dinamicamente.

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

Esta é a tabela de Agrupamento que criei para a solução. Temos nossas colunas Groups (faixas etárias), Sort Order , Min e Max . Acabei de inventar os números aqui, mas você pode reorganizar ou personalizar isso para seus próprios relatórios.

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

Eu usei o Enter Data para criar esta tabela.

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

A coluna Sort Order é fundamental quando temos valor de texto. Temos que ter certeza de que podemos classificar por algo para que os valores fiquem na ordem correta se os estivermos mostrando em uma visualização.

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

Esta tabela não tem relação com nada no modelo de dados. Eu chamo tabelas como esta de suporte ou tabelas secundárias. Em seguida, iteramos por essa tabela e executamos a lógica por meio dela

Fazendo o cálculo DAX

A primeira coisa que precisamos fazer é algo bem simples, que é somar a coluna Valor .

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

Isso nos dará uma medida central que gera algum valor para nós. Na verdade, não podemos usar isso porque não há relacionamento entre nossa tabela Transaction e nossa tabela Group. Teremos que fazer a filtragem dentro de uma fórmula. 

Portanto, esta é a fórmula que utilizamos. Eu o chamo de Values ​​Per Group e contém várias funções DAX.

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X

Esse cálculo, por fim, retornará o valor total , mas precisamos iterar em cada linha da tabela de transações . Em cada linha, precisamos calcular a diferença ( DATEDIFF ) nessas datas ( Due Date e Clearing Date ).

Em outras palavras, em cada linha, estamos calculando as diferenças de data entre essas duas colunas. Ao mesmo tempo, também percorremos todas as linhas da tabela Grupo de devedores idosos . Se esta lógica for verdadeira, a lógica COUNTROWS também será verdadeira. Neste caso, retornará Valor Total .

Podemos então transformar esses cálculos em visualizações.

Técnica de agrupamento do LuckyTemplates: balancete antigo usando DAX


Use DAX para segmentar e agrupar dados no
exemplo de segmentação do LuckyTemplates usando DAX avançado no LuckyTemplates
Análise avançada do LuckyTemplates: técnicas de lógica de tabela secundária

Conclusão

Este tutorial é um exemplo exclusivo de como você pode utilizar algumas das técnicas de agrupamento e segmentação do LuckyTemplates em seus modelos. É um ótimo aplicativo, tanto do ponto de vista contábil quanto do ponto de vista da análise financeira.

Criamos uma tabela de suporte e usamos algumas fórmulas DAX avançadas para obter os insights que procuramos. Esse tipo de análise é muito bom do ponto de vista da gestão de caixa e dos negócios.

Tudo de bom!

Leave a Comment

Colunas calculadas no SharePoint | Uma visão geral

Colunas calculadas no SharePoint | Uma visão geral

Descubra a importância das colunas calculadas no SharePoint e como elas podem realizar cálculos automáticos e obtenção de dados em suas listas.

Atributos pré-atentivos: como isso pode afetar seu relatório

Atributos pré-atentivos: como isso pode afetar seu relatório

Descubra todos os atributos pré-atentivos e saiba como isso pode impactar significativamente seu relatório do LuckyTemplates

Calcular Dias de Estoque Zero – LuckyTemplates Inventory Management Insights

Calcular Dias de Estoque Zero – LuckyTemplates Inventory Management Insights

Aprenda a contar o número total de dias em que você não tinha estoque por meio dessa técnica eficaz de gerenciamento de inventário do LuckyTemplates.

Usando exibições de gerenciamento dinâmico (DMV) no DAX Studio

Usando exibições de gerenciamento dinâmico (DMV) no DAX Studio

Saiba mais sobre as exibições de gerenciamento dinâmico (DMV) no DAX Studio e como usá-las para carregar conjuntos de dados diretamente no LuckyTemplates.

Variáveis ​​e expressões dentro do editor do Power Query

Variáveis ​​e expressões dentro do editor do Power Query

Este tutorial irá discutir sobre Variáveis e Expressões dentro do Editor do Power Query, destacando a importância de variáveis M e sua sintaxe.

Como calcular a diferença em dias entre compras usando o DAX no LuckyTemplates

Como calcular a diferença em dias entre compras usando o DAX no LuckyTemplates

Aprenda a calcular a diferença em dias entre compras usando DAX no LuckyTemplates com este guia completo.

Calculando a média no LuckyTemplates: isolando os resultados do dia da semana ou do fim de semana usando o DAX

Calculando a média no LuckyTemplates: isolando os resultados do dia da semana ou do fim de semana usando o DAX

Calcular uma média no LuckyTemplates envolve técnicas DAX para obter dados precisos em relatórios de negócios.

O que é self em Python: exemplos do mundo real

O que é self em Python: exemplos do mundo real

O que é self em Python: exemplos do mundo real

Como salvar e carregar um arquivo RDS em R

Como salvar e carregar um arquivo RDS em R

Você aprenderá como salvar e carregar objetos de um arquivo .rds no R. Este blog também abordará como importar objetos do R para o LuckyTemplates.

Primeiros N dias úteis revisitados - uma solução de linguagem de codificação DAX

Primeiros N dias úteis revisitados - uma solução de linguagem de codificação DAX

Neste tutorial de linguagem de codificação DAX, aprenda como usar a função GENERATE e como alterar um título de medida dinamicamente.